The sun shone through the clouds, dappling on her phoenix coronet and bridal robe, dazzling but also reflecting the subtle fatigue and boredom between her brows. But Xie Chaochao, the queen above all others, felt unprecedented turmoil in her heart - she didn't want to be this queen anymore.
At first, this thought was like a petal that fell carelessly in spring, gentle and fleeting. But as time went by, it gradually took root and sprouted, until it grew into a towering tree, occupying her entire heart. Every night when it was quiet, she sat alone in the palace with carved beams and painted rafters, looking at the lonely bright moon outside the window, and her heart was filled with endless emotions. It turned out that behind this seemingly glorious position of queen was endless responsibility and restraint, and it was the toil and bitterness that every maid and eunuch could not escape.
She recalled those days, when the first rays of sunlight in the morning had not yet penetrated the clouds, the maids and eunuchs in the palace were already busy, carrying heavy food boxes and shuttling between the palaces, or carefully cleaning every inch of floor tiles, for fear of disturbing the sweet dreams of their masters. Even in the cold winter, when their hands were red from the cold, they still stood firm at their posts, not daring to slack off. Although she herself was the queen, she was often overwhelmed by the cumbersome etiquette and complicated interpersonal relationships. Behind those seemingly glamorous appearances were countless days and nights of loneliness and helplessness.
Xie Chaochao began to reflect, is this really the life she wanted? In this deep palace, she lost her freedom, her smile, and even herself. Every night, she could always hear low sobbing in the distance, that is, a palace maid worrying about her family, or crying for her unknown fate. Those sounds, like fine needles, deeply hurt her heart.
Finally, on a stormy night, Xie Chaochao made a decision. She wanted to break free from this golden cage and find her own sky, even if the road ahead was unknown and even if it was full of wind and rain. She knew that this road would be full of challenges and dangers, but she knew that only by taking this step could she truly live out her true self and no longer be shrouded by the shadow of this palace.
So, she began to plan secretly, carefully collecting information and resources that could help her escape from it all. Every step was like walking on thin ice, but her heart was filled with unprecedented determination and courage. Because she knew that once she took this step, she would no longer be the queen trapped in the deep palace, but a soul bravely pursuing freedom.
Xie Chaochao rubbed her aching shoulders tiredly. Long hours of work made her spine seem to be oppressed by invisible weight. Every slight turn was accompanied by a subtle but hard to ignore sound. The afterglow of the setting sun shone through the window lattice, sprinkling on her slightly messy desk, adding a touch of warm color to this slightly monotonous space. She sighed, finally put down the pen in her hand, and decided to give her body and mind a short vacation.
On the dining table, next to a bowl of steaming white rice, there were a few simple but delicious home-cooked dishes. That was the dinner she cooked herself. Although it was not luxurious, it was full of warmth. Every bite of food seemed to dispel a trace of fatigue and let her mind get a moment of peace. After dinner, she simply cleaned up the dishes and walked into the bathroom. The warm water poured down from her head, washing away her fatigue and dust of the day, as if washing away all the troubled thoughts.
When she walked out of the bathroom in a loose pajamas with her hair casually draped over her shoulders, time had quietly slipped into the depths of the night. The moonlight was like water, quietly sprinkling in the quaint courtyard, covering this quiet night with a layer of mysterious silver gauze. Xie Chaochao looked up and looked out the window, ready to enjoy this rare tranquility, but suddenly, her eyes were fixed on the center of the courtyard - a man in black stood there quietly, like a ghost in the night, silent and in sharp contrast with the surrounding environment.
His figure was tall and cold, and his black outfit almost blended into the night, revealing only two sharp eagle eyes that flashed coldly under the moonlight. He was motionless, like a sculpture, but he exuded an indescribable dangerous aura that made the air in the entire yard seem to freeze.
Xie Chaochao's heartbeat suddenly accelerated, and an inexplicable fear and curiosity intertwined, causing her body to freeze in place. She suppressed her panic and tried to calm herself down. Her mind was spinning rapidly, thinking about the various possibilities of the scene in front of her. Was it a thief walking at night? Or a visitor with some special purpose? In this quiet night, the sudden appearance of a man in black undoubtedly added a bit of unknown excitement and danger to her life.
Xie Chaochao's heart suddenly shrank, as if it was tightly grasped by an invisible hand. She took a few steps back involuntarily, and each step was stepped on the fragments of memory. The grievances and hatreds about the palace surged like a tide and drowned her. Under the moonlight, her figure looked thin and stubborn, with a light of vigilance and doubt flashing in her eyes.
The man in black in front of him was tall and straight, his face hidden under the shadow of his hood, revealing only a pair of sharp eyes like a falcon, as if he could see into the deepest secrets of people's hearts. He nodded slowly, the movement was concise and powerful, like a judge who pronounced a fate, every subtle movement revealed unquestionable authority.
"Are you Emperor Chu Heng's man?" Xie Chaochao's voice trembled slightly, but she still tried her best to stay calm. She tried to find a flaw in the other person's eyes, perhaps sympathy, or hesitation, but there was only cold determination.
The man in black sighed softly, his voice was low and magnetic, as if it could penetrate the night and reach people's hearts: "Yes, my lady, it is not easy to find you. The emperor is looking forward to it day and night, and only hopes that you can return to the palace and continue our relationship."
"Renew our past relationship?" Xie Chaochao smiled bitterly. These four words were like a sharp blade, gently cutting through her already scarred heart. The past intertwined with power, betrayal and love was like a nightmare from which she could not wake up. From the moment she fled the palace, she swore that she would never look back.
However, at this moment, facing this sudden call, Xie Chaochao's heart was in turmoil. The palace, the place where her dream began, has now become the cage she is most reluctant to face. She closed her eyes, and Chu Heng's deep eyes appeared in her mind. There was the tenderness and affection she once longed for, but also endless calculations and secrets.
